Tepic's event options range from hotel conference facilities and business centres clustered around the Avenida México corridor to hacienda-style properties on the city's quieter outskirts that work well for full-day seminars or leadership away days. The neighbourhood around the historic centre also has restored colonial buildings that suit smaller product launches or executive dinners. Tepic sits at the edge of the Sierra Madre Occidental foothills, so guided cultural excursions to Huichol artisan communities give teams something genuinely memorable and local. The city's markets, like the Mercado Municipal, work well for informal group experiences that mix food and culture without feeling forced. For something more active, the nearby Laguna Santa María del Oro is a short drive out and offers a natural setting for group activities away from the boardroom. These kinds of experiences tend to stick with people longer than another afternoon in a meeting room.
